Output 809649f39b3b01e01bf861b4c8800946c4b738e119e1161d9a79b6341bd42dc9:24

value
150015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11057eb0b68db205dd5b8e008e67e00c7aecfc5 OP_EQUAL
address
3KHqv8QQuuMx7cm5E6SZnTcbs53krpWqdt
transaction
809649f39b3b01e01bf861b4c8800946c4b738e119e1161d9a79b6341bd42dc9
spent
true